cancel
Showing results for 
Search instead for 
Did you mean: 
cancel
385
Views
0
Helpful
1
Replies

My AP 4800 isn't update image

megasoporteCR
Level 1
Level 1

Saludos gente,

Tengo un problema con algunos AP.

Currently I have a Cisco 3802i Controller AP, I am going to install one more AP, this is a 4800 (not controller), at the moment I connect the AP so that the controller recognizes it, it does not want to recognize it, their versions are: 8.10.162.0 (AP 38000) and 8.7.106.0 (AP 4800).

I tried to update the image to my AP 4800, but it won't let me update it, I've tried with .tar .zip images and also installing Ap3g3 but I can't install it, the error it gives me is the following:

Iniciando la descarga de la imagen ME...
La descarga puede tardar unos minutos en finalizar.
Si es más largo, cancele el comando, verifique la conexión de red e intente nuevamente
################################# ################################## 100.0%
Transferencia de imagen completa.
Imagen descargada, escribiendo en flash...
haz CHECK_ME, la parte 1 es parte activa
La firma de la imagen verifica el éxito.
upgrade.sh: la parte para actualizar es la parte
2 upgrade.sh: la versión de la imagen 8.10.162.0 parece dañada. Reintentar agotado. Para de escribir.
+ do_upgrade CHECK_ME
+ [ ! -r /tmp/part.tar ]
+ [ 1 -lt 3 ]
+ local base_vol=/dev/ubivol
+ local action=CHECK_ME
+ cat /MERAKI_BOARD
+ local board=barbados
+ get_activepart
+ get_activepart_real
+ cat /proc/cmdline
+ local kcmdline=console=ttyS0,9600 activepart=part1 activeboot=0 bootver=0x140 boardid=0x26 nss_emac_map=0x3 wired0=0 phy0=mv2010 nfcConfig=4bitecc mtdparts=armada-nand:1m (ups),1m(reservado),-(fs) ubi.mtd=fs wired1=1 phy1=mvl crashkernel=500M-:128M@128M usbcore.authorized_default=0
+ echo console=ttyS0,9600
+ grep activepart
+ echo activepart =part1
+ grep activepart
+ echo activepart=part1
+ awk -F= {print $2}
+ echo activeboot=0
+ grep activepart
+ echo bootver=0x140
+ grep activepart
+ echo boardid=0x26
+ grep activepart
+ echo nss_emac_map=0x3
+ grep parte activa
+ echo wired0=0
+ grep activepart
+ echo phy0=mv2010
+ grep activepart
+ echo nfcConfig=4bitecc
+ grep activepart
+ echo mtdparts=armada-nand:1m(ups),1m(reservado),-(fs)
+ grep activepart
+ echo ubi.mtd=fs
+ grep activepart
+ echo wired1=1
+ grep activepart
+ echo phy1=mvl
+ grep activepart
+ echo crashkernel=500M-:128M@128M
+ grep activepart
+ echo usbcore.authorized_default=0
+ grep activepart
+ local parte_activa=parte1
+ [ parte1 != parte1 -a parte1 != parte2 ]
+ echo parte1
+ parte_activa local=parte1
+ get_alternateboot parte1
+ [ parte1 == parte2 ]
+ echo part2
+ local part_to_upgrade=part2
+ local eff_upgrade_master=false
+ local tftp_image_vers=
+ local skip_img_sign_verify=false
+ local skip_boot_upgrade=false
+ echo
+ tr , \n
+ echo peligroso 12628
+ sync
+ cd /tmp
+ [ barbados == barbados ]
+ tar -xf /tmp/part.tar info.ver info btldr.img setenv.gz
+ plat_is_bootloader_dev_version
+ cat /var/platform/bootloader_raw_version
+ local RAW_VERSION=0x140
+ echo 0
+ [ 0 -ne 0 ]
+ [ CHECK_ME = = CHECK_ME ]
+ tar -xvf /tmp/part.tar me_image
+ check_me
+ [ ! -r me_image ]
+ get_capwap_version
+ [ 0 -lt 1 ]
+ local version_file=/tmp/info.ver
+ [ -f /tmp/info.ver ]
+ grep ^ws_management_version /tmp/info.ver
+ sed s/.*: //g
+ echo 8.10.162.0
+ local capwap_version= 8.10.162.0
+ /usr/sbin/getoffset /tmp/part.tar part.bin
+ local fileoffset= Nombre de archivo part.bin Offset 62490624 Longitud 6278317 Código de error 0
+ echo Nombre de archivo part.bin Offset 62490624 Longitud 6278317 Código de error 0
+ cut -f4 - d
+ local partfileoffset=62490624
+ echo Nombre de archivo part.bin Offset 62490624 Longitud 6278317 Código de error 0
+ cut -f6 -d
+ local partfilesize=6278317
+ echo Nombre de archivo part.bin Offset 62490624 Longitud 6278317 Código de error 0
+ cut -f8 -d + código de error
local =0
+ [[ 0 -ne 0 ]]
+ [falso!= verdadero]
+ image_signing_verify 62490624
+ [! -r /tmp/part.tar ]
+ /usr/sbin/verify /tmp/part.tar part.bin
+ local retval= Nombre de archivo part.bin Offset 62490624 Longitud 6278317 Código de error 0
Verificar devuelve 0
+ echo Nombre de archivo part.bin Offset 62490624 Longitud 6278317 Código de error 0 La verificación devuelve 0
+ corte -f8 -d
+ código de error local=0
+ [[ 0 -eq 0 ]]
+ eco La firma de la imagen verifica el éxito.
La firma de la imagen verifica el éxito.
+ return 0
+ local ret=0
+ [ 0 -ne 0 ]
+ [ falso != verdadero ]
+ [ barbados == barbados -a -e /usr/bin/btldr_upgrade ]
+ [ -f /lib/firmware/btldr. img ]
+ [ -f /lib/firmware/setenv.gz ]
+ barbados_boot_upgrade
+ plat_get_bootloader_booted
+ cat /var/platform/bootloader_booted
+ local BOOTED=0
+ plat_get_bootloader_version
+ cat /var/platform/bootloader_version
+ local BOOTVER=0x140
+ [ /tmp != /tmp ]
+ [ -f btldr.img -a ! -z 0 -a ! -z 0x140 ]
+ [ -f setenv.gz ]
+ [ 1 -eq 0 ]
+ local CLEAR_ENV_FLAG=
+ local ENVUTIL=/usr/bin/shared_printenv
+ local NEW_ENVUTIL=./setenv
+ [ -e /usr/bin/shared_printenv -a -e ./setenv ]
+ /usr/bin/btldr_upgrade -b 0 -v 0x140 btldr.img
+ [ 0 -ne 0 ]
+ la parte de loudlog para actualizar es part2
+ logger -p 0 -t actualizar la parte para actualizar es part2
+ pgrep switchdrvr
+ pid locales =
+ [-z]
+ echo upgrade.sh: la parte a actualizar es part2
upgrade.sh: la parte a actualizar es part2
+ [ barbados == barbados ]
+ is_retry_allowed UPGRADE_8.10.162.0
+ local count_fname=/storage/UPGRADE_8.10.162.0_COUNT
+ cat /storage /UPGRADE_8.10.162.0_COUNT
+ recuento local=3
+ [ 3 -lt 3 ]
+ return 0
+ [ 0 -ne 1 ]
+ loudlog La versión 8.10.162.0 de la imagen parece dañada. Reintentar agotado. Para de escribir.
+ logger -p 0 -t upgrade La versión 8.10.162.0 de la imagen parece dañada. Reintentar agotado. Para de escribir.
+ pgrep switchdrvr
+ local pids=
+ [ -z ]
+ echo upgrade.sh: la versión de la imagen 8.10.162.0 parece dañada. Reintentar agotado. Para de escribir.
upgrade.sh: la versión de la imagen 8.10.162.0 parece dañada. Reintentar agotado. Para de escribir.
+ return 1
+ status=1
+ set +x
Error: la actualización de la imagen falló.

 

Alguien me podría ayudar a explicar como hacer la actualización del AP o que mi controlador, el cisco 3802i, vea ese AP 4800?

1 Reply 1

Rich R
VIP
VIP

Just do it the way Mobility Express was designed to work.
Set up a TFTP server.
Unzip the ME 8.10.162.0 zipfile image bundle on the TFTP server https://software.cisco.com/download/home/286319691/type/286289839/release/8.10.162.0
Configure the TFTP server details on your 3800 ME controller.
When the 4800 tries to join ME will automatically direct it to download the correct image from the TFTP server.

If you want to do it manually then start by converting the 4800 AP from ME to CAPWAP (if it's currently ME)
Then install the 8.10.162.0 CAPWAP image on the AP: https://software.cisco.com/download/home/286319691/type/286288051/release/15.3.3-JK6
Then the AP will be able to join the ME as a subordinate AP and if you want to you can then convert to ME.

Review Cisco Networking for a $25 gift card